How to fill out site plan 1

How to fill out site plan 1
01
Gather all necessary information about the site, such as property boundaries, existing structures, and topographic features.
02
Use a computer-aided design (CAD) software or a site planning tool to create a digital platform for the site plan.
03
Start by drawing the property boundaries accurately on the site plan.
04
Add existing structures, such as buildings, driveways, and fences, to the site plan using accurate measurements.
05
Include important features like trees, water bodies, utility lines, and access points on the site plan.
06
Label each element on the site plan clearly to avoid any confusion.
07
Consider any legal or building code requirements when filling out the site plan, such as setback regulations or easements.
08
Review the completed site plan for accuracy and make any necessary revisions before finalizing it.
09
Once the site plan is complete, print multiple copies for future reference and submit the required copies to the relevant authorities, such as planning departments or building permit offices.
Who needs site plan 1?
01
Site plan 1 is typically required by architects, engineers, contractors, or land developers.
02
It is necessary for obtaining building permits, designing new structures or developments, assessing property value, or complying with zoning regulations.
03
In addition, city planners, local government officials, and environmental agencies may also require site plan 1 to review and approve proposed projects.

What is site plan 1?
Site Plan 1 is a document that outlines the details of a specific site development project, including the layout, zoning, and intended use of the property.
Who is required to file site plan 1?
Typically, property developers, builders, and landowners are required to file Site Plan 1 to ensure compliance with local zoning laws and regulations.
How to fill out site plan 1?
To fill out Site Plan 1, applicants should provide detailed information about the site, including property boundaries, existing structures, proposed changes, and any environmental considerations.
What is the purpose of site plan 1?
The purpose of Site Plan 1 is to review and assess the proposed development's compatibility with local zoning requirements and to ensure it meets safety, environmental, and aesthetic standards.
What information must be reported on site plan 1?
Site Plan 1 must report information such as site boundaries, topography, proposed land use, building dimensions, parking layouts, and landscaping plans.
